TATREN TPO 12 76 is a controlled rheology extra high impact resistance thermoplastic polyolefin with exceptional impact properties even at low temperatures. It is a grade of medium fluidity and contains nucleating agent. TATREN TPO 12 76 is characterized by exceptionally high impact resistance even at minus temperatures and very good impact/stiffness balance.

Polymer Name: Thermoplastic Polyolefin (TPO)

Processing Methods: Compounding, Injection Molding

Features: Cost Effective, Good Balance of Properties, High Stiffness, Impact Resistance, Improved Fluidity, Low Temperature Impact Resistance, Nucleated, Recyclable

Applications

TATREN TPO 12 76 is intended especially for compounding and subsequent injection molding of products where excellent impact resistance at minus temperatures is required. This grade is intended to be used in automotive industry. In regard of extra high impact properties of the grade it is very often not necessary to add any rubber modifier for the purpose to increase impact behavior for heavy applications. When used in blends it also allows usage of higher portion of regranulates while there is not deterioration of impact properties, which makes this grade to be economically very attractive raw material. TATREN TPO 12 76 is suitable for food contact. The product complies with Food Contact Regulations.

Processing

TATREN TPO 12 76 can be processed on standard injection molding machines. Recommended processing temperatures are 190 - 250 °C.

Recycling

Polypropylene resins are suitable for recycling using modern recycling methods. In-house production waste should be kept clean to facilitate direct recycling.

Reach Statement

Polymers are exempt of REACH registration. However, their raw materials which mean monomers and relevant additives have been registered. SLOVNAFT, as. is committed to fully respect legislation and will only use REACH compliant raw materials. At this point in time PP TATREN does not contain any substances specifically identified as SVHC at levels greater than 0.1%.

Storage and Handling

Pellets are packed in 25 kg PE-LD bags and transported on stretch or shrink-wrapped pallets at eligible load of polymer 1375 kg. Heat treated pallets are available as well. We use adhesive between the bags in order to avoid their slipping. Pay attention to this fact during the removing of the bags from the pallets. The preferred method is to lift the bag at first without rotation. Transportation in a road silo or rail silo is also available. 

Since polypropylene is a combustible substance, the fire safety rules applicable for combustible materials in warehouses and store rooms should be observed.

If polymer is stored in conditions of high humidity and fluctuating temperatures, then atmospheric moisture can condense inside the packing. If it happened, it is recommended the pellets to be dried before use. During the storage polypropylene should not be exposed to UV radiation and temperatures above 40°C.
